Meaning of tanzaku | Babel Free

Noun CEFR B1

Definitions

  1. A slip of paper that can be written on, especially those hung on bamboo or other trees during the Tanabata festival.
  2. A hanafuda playing card depicting a tanzaku (slip of paper) attached to the plant corresponding to the card's suit.
